Babylonian and Assyrian Institute

The Babylonian and Assyrian Institutes are scholarly organizations dedicated to studying and preserving the history, culture, language, and archaeology of ancient Mesopotamian civilizations. The Babylonian Institute focuses on the heritage of Babylonian civilization, while the Assyrian Institute concentrates on Assyrian history and culture. These institutes conduct research, publish findings, and support academic and cultural initiatives to deepen understanding of these ancient societies that significantly influenced human history through innovations in writing, law, and urban development. They serve as centers for scholarship, helping to keep the legacy of Mesopotamian cultures alive today.
